Frequently asked questions about cottages in Nova Scotia

  • What are the top must-see attractions in Nova Scotia, Canada?

    Nova Scotia boasts many incredible sights! For history buffs, Halifax Citadel National Historic Site and the Maritime Museum of the Atlantic are essential. The Cabot Trail, a scenic coastal drive on Cape Breton Island, offers breathtaking views and charming towns like Cheticamp and Ingonish. Peggy's Cove, with its iconic lighthouse, is another must-see, and Lunenburg, a UNESCO World Heritage site, is a beautifully preserved historic town. The Bay of Fundy's high tides are also a phenomenal natural wonder, best experienced at Hopewell Rocks.

  • What weather, wildlife, or natural hazards might affect travellers in Nova Scotia, Canada?

    Nova Scotia's weather can be unpredictable. Expect mild summers and cool, often wet, winters. Pack layers! Wildlife encounters are possible; moose are common in rural areas, and black bears exist, though attacks are rare. Be aware of your surroundings and store food properly. Coastal areas can experience strong winds and fog, especially during autumn and winter. Check weather forecasts before embarking on outdoor activities.

  • Is Nova Scotia, Canada pedestrian and cyclist-friendly?

    Many areas of Nova Scotia are pedestrian and cyclist-friendly, particularly in towns and cities like Halifax and Lunenburg. Halifax has dedicated bike lanes and walking paths. However, rural areas often have limited sidewalks and higher traffic volumes, so cyclists should exercise caution. The Cabot Trail offers stunning cycling routes, but be prepared for hills and some challenging sections.

  • Are there any unusual or hidden places to explore in Nova Scotia, Canada?

    Many hidden gems exist! The Cape Breton Highlands National Park offers numerous hiking trails with spectacular views, including the Skyline Trail. The Bras d'Or Lake, a unique saltwater lake, is a great spot for kayaking or canoeing. The village of Tangier, accessible only by boat, is a charming and secluded fishing community. For a unique experience, visit the Fortress of Louisbourg National Historic Site.

  • What are some of the best cultural experiences that allow one to meet locals in Nova Scotia, Canada?

    Visiting local farmers' markets is a great way to interact with Nova Scotians and sample regional produce. Attending a ceilidh (a traditional Gaelic social gathering with music and dancing), particularly in Cape Breton, offers a vibrant cultural experience and opportunities to meet locals. Many pubs and restaurants offer live music, providing a relaxed atmosphere for socialising. Participating in a guided tour, especially one focused on local history or crafts, can also lead to interactions with knowledgeable locals.
  • What are the best authentic dishes to taste in Nova Scotia, Canada?

    Nova Scotia's cuisine is influenced by its maritime heritage. Seafood is a staple; try lobster rolls, fresh oysters, or fish and chips. Donair, a Middle Eastern-inspired meat wrap, is a local favourite. Blueberry pancakes or pies showcase the province's abundant blueberries. For a unique experience, sample some locally made apple cider or craft beer.
